Responsibilities
• Host client-facing review meetings and offer strategic financial guidance
• Execute full-cycle month-end close across multiple client files, from reconciliations to reporting
• Monitor due dates and deliverables using Keeper, ensuring all steps of close are met on schedule
• Maintain clean and consistent general ledgers by coding all transactions in QBO
• Build and update custom client charts of accounts based on Lodestar’s proprietary framework
• Prepare and document all necessary balance sheet reconciliations and support schedules
• Enter and manage journal entries for prepaids, accruals, fixed assets, loans, and payroll allocations
• Ensure QBO bank feeds are up-to-date and that all entries have appropriate supporting documentation
Requirements/Qualifications
• Bachelor’s degree in accounting or related field
• 7+ years of accounting experience (multi-client or outsourced accounting preferred)
• Strong working knowledge of GAAP and month-end close procedures
• Demonstrated ability to handle a high volume of accounting work with speed and accuracy
• Proficiency in QuickBooks Online and Excel (pivot tables, formulas, etc.)
• Highly organized and consistent in documentation, naming conventions, and workpaper management
• Able to follow detailed SOPs while identifying and flagging areas for potential process improvement
